<h4>Description</h4> This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ial supplies prepared in accordance with the format in FAR 12.6,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; QUOTATIONS are being requested and A WRITTEN SOLICITATION WILL NOT BE ISSUED. The solicitation number is AG- 04M3-S-08-0015 and this requirement is being issued as a Request for Quote. The procurement is 100% set-aside for small business. The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) number is 423830 - small business size standard is 100 employees. The USDA Forest Service, Department of Agriculture, Forest Service, R-6 Blue Mountain Area, PO Box 907, Baker City, OR 97814. The scope of work consists of supply and delivery of 1 Class 931 Forklift. Quote prices may be faxed to 541-523-1215. Technical Specifications: 6,000 to 6,500 pounds Fuel: L.P. Gas - 2.2 L engine or larger Automatic idle up system Automatic power shift transmission Dual pneumatic tires Active stability control Semi-suspension seat with orange colored seat belt Power steering Hydraulic brakes Forks: 48 inches in length with automatic fork leveling control Hydraulic side shifting fork positioner Driving lights - front and rear - one amber beacon in rear Back up alarm (smart alarm) Upright: 90 inch overall lowered height, including canopy Overall lifting height 200 inches max Shop and Parts manual need to be provided at time of delivery Operators manual 2 each QUOTE PRICE $__________________ DELIVERY: After notice of award the vendor will have 45 days to deliver the equipment to the Government at the Malheur National Forest, Automotive Shop, 150 Government Road, John Day, OR. Attn: Ben Lindley at 541-575-3709. INSPECTION: Inspection will be done when delivered to Malheur National Forest, by either Ben Lindley or Charles Bowden. The forklift must past inspection before acceptance.
